A personal account by renowned railway artist, Eric Leslie, who began his working life in the early 1950s as an apprentice carpenter with British Rail. It covers over 40 years of his involvement in the narrow gauge movement – from early days helping lay track to more recent work illustrating cards and posters for preservation societies. Featuring a collection of his charming and evocative watercolours, it’s a fitting tribute to the many narrow gauge railway volunteers and will delight all steam railway fans.

This book covers 12 narrow gauge railways and includes 2 paintings of the Corris – ‘Busy day at Escairgeiliog. No.3 waits for passengers’ and ‘Rainy Day at Aberllefenni’. Also included and personally illustrated are the Lynton & Barnstaple, Ashover, Ffestiniog, Leek & Manifold, Mull, Talyllyn, Welsh Highland and Welshpool & Llanfair Railways, plus the Denver & Rio Grande Railroad and Slate Quarries.
